                                     Lizzie Creek Winter Holidays trip -December 25th-29th 2013
                                           Tabletop,Anemone,Arrowhead and Tynemouth Peaks

Adrien suggested to get out for few days and celebrate winter holidays somewhere in a nice are in a hut with a small group and of course we all said yes and he suggested as our first option Lizzie Creek area.

So here we are in the morning of December 25th we left Vancouver with out huge and heavy packs in the car and started our drive towards Pemberton from where we continued our way to In-Shuck-ch Main to Phacelia Creek Road on which we drove a bit over 1km and parked at the old spur road that used to be ok a while ago.

Our backpacks were pretty heavy, some of us needed help to get them on with skis and ski boots on.




We started our way up with hiking up the road to the first turn where the new Lizzie Creek trail starts which is a detour to pass the slide on the road.

The detour is not that long but it's pretty steep and felt pretty hard with those huge packs and skis.



Soon we finally got on the road and started our way.

The further we were going in those bushes were getting worse.



Soon we got to a point where we could finally leave our shoes and switch to skis which made our packs a little bit lighter.

Then the heavy bushwhacking began and slowed us down pretty bad and it was getting worse and worse and in some spots we were thinking how are we going to ski this madness on our way down.

Once we got higher on the road we could finally see some views back towards Lillooet Lake and we knew that Lizzie Lake wasn't far now and the bushes were gone but now we had more snow and was harder for us to brake trail.




By the time we got to the lake it was getting pretty dark already and once we crossed the lake we had to start using our hedlamps.



Our mistake was that we left the summer trail and crossed the lake and it took us a while to find the summer trail after that.

After few hours of battling the steep terrain that we had to deal with to get back on the trail we decided that we should just stop, sleep there and continue tomorrow with a better light.

Adrien had a 2 person tent and Ben and Dean had bivy's.

I had some beers that I was hoping to drink in the hut but decided to give everybody a beer and have them now since it was Christmas day.



The next morning we woke up all cold and we didn't even had breakfast and decided to just go and get to the hut and have some food there.



Didn't took us long to find the trail marker and form there it was mostly traversing in the forest and much easier terrain.



Soon we got to the hut, we chose our beds and made some food after what we started our way towards Tabletop Mountain with just 3 of us while Adrien decided to stay in for this one.



The weather wasn't the best and it was getting pretty cloudy as we were going higher up and required a lot of navigation.




Just before the summit we left our skis and bootpacked the last bit to the summit of Tabletop Mountain.







Skiing back down to the hut was marginal,pretty slow skiing since we were in the clouds for most of the time.

Once we got back to the hut we got the fire going and started our dinners.




And I brought a Santa with me which I left it in the hut at the of the trip.




On the third day the weather still didn't improved,was still pretty cloudy but we still decided to get out and do something and decided to go for Anemone Peak after what we got back down to the hut and did a small run in Longs Peak area in the evening.











On the fourth day we finally got the good weather and we decided to go for Arrowhead and  Tynemouth Peaks, we went up first Arrowhead Peak from where we dropped a bit and then continued our way towards Tynemouth peak.













































 At the end of the day we did a small run again near Tarn peak.

On our fifth day it was time to leave but none of us were excited about that overgrown road section, this time we followed the summer trail for a bit more and me and Adrien decided to just drop down to the lake and cross it while Ben and Dean stayed on the summer trail, but in the end all of us got at the same time by the road.





Skiing down the road wasn't fun at all, the part without bushes was ok but once we entered the bushes we decided to take our skis off earlier and just walk the road.







Near the new hiking trail, Adrien decided to just follow the road and cross the creek since the creek crossing was just by the car and Dean went with him while me and Ben took the detour trail.

Once we got to the car we see Adrien wet and a bit scared, the creek was much higher and stronger than he tough and almost took him down the stream.

In the end it was a great trip in a new area and we had the entire area for ourselves, too bad we only had good weather just for one day while we were there.
